Browser Terms Explained: QR Code API

Get SigmaOS Free

It's free and super easy to set up

Browser Terms Explained: QR Code API

Get SigmaOS Free

It's free and super easy to set up

Browser Terms Explained: QR Code API

Get SigmaOS Free

It's free and super easy to set up

Browser Terms Explained: QR Code API

In this article, we will provide an in-depth explanation of one of the most commonly used technologies today - QR codes, and how they are integrated into modern web platforms through APIs. We will start by understanding QR codes and then move on to the basics of APIs, before diving into the main topic of QR code APIs. Additionally, we will also explain how to generate QR codes using APIs and the customization options available to enhance their appearance.

Understanding QR Codes

QR codes, also known as quick response codes, store information on a square grid of black and white squares. These codes can store a variety of information, including website links, contact details, and promotional offers. The technology behind QR codes was first developed by Toyota in 1994 to manage their production process, but it was only in recent years that they became popular for commercial use.

What is a QR Code?

A QR code is a two-dimensional barcode that can be easily scanned using a smartphone camera or a QR code scanner. These codes can store both alphanumeric and numeric data and can be used in various ways. For example, businesses often use QR codes to display their website links, promotion codes, and product information.

QR codes have become increasingly popular due to their ease of use and versatility. They can be printed on a variety of materials, such as paper, plastic, and fabric, and can be scanned from a distance or up close. QR codes can also be customized with different colors and designs to make them more visually appealing.

How QR Codes Work

QR codes are read and interpreted by software that uses a device's camera to scan the code. The software then analyzes the pattern of the dark and light squares to decipher the information stored in the code. Once the code is scanned, the user can access the information stored in the code, such as a website, promotional offer, or contact information.

QR codes can also be used for more advanced purposes, such as tracking products and monitoring inventory. By scanning a QR code on a product, businesses can track its location, delivery status, and other important details. This allows for more efficient supply chain management and improved customer service.

Common Uses of QR Codes

QR codes are used in a variety of ways, from advertising and marketing to tracking products and making payments. For example, businesses can create QR codes to promote a new product or offer a free trial. Additionally, QR codes can be utilized to store information for payment methods like Apple Pay, Google Wallet, or PayPal.

QR codes are also commonly used in the food and beverage industry. Restaurants can use QR codes to display their menus, allow customers to order and pay for their meals, and even provide nutritional information about their dishes. This not only improves the customer experience but also reduces the need for physical menus and cash transactions.

In conclusion, QR codes have become an integral part of modern technology and are used in a variety of industries for a multitude of purposes. From advertising and marketing to supply chain management and payment methods, QR codes offer a convenient and efficient way to store and access information.

Introduction to APIs

In today's digital world, websites regularly communicate with each other, using Application Programming Interfaces (APIs). APIs are used to share information between different software applications and platforms. Essentially, APIs act as an intermediary, allowing two different software applications to communicate with each other.

What is an API?

An Application Programming Interface (API) refers to the set of protocols, tools, and routines used to build software applications. APIs allow different software programs to communicate with one another, enabling different databases and services to share data.

How APIs Work

APIs work by receiving a request from a software application and returning a set of responses. The responses can either be in text or coded format. Once the API receives the request, it triggers the necessary actions, retrieves the data from the server, and then sends it back to the original software application.

Benefits of Using APIs

APIs offer numerous benefits to software developers and businesses. APIs can improve data accessibility, enhance software functionality, and assist in building new products. Additionally, APIs can help organizations grow their customer base and increase their revenue streams by enabling partnerships between businesses.

QR Code APIs: The Basics

QR code APIs enable software developers to build QR code functionality into their software applications. These APIs can be used to generate QR codes, read QR codes, and also to customize the appearance of the codes. QR code APIs are typically offered by third-party providers who allow their API to be integrated into other software programs, such as websites or mobile applications.

What is a QR Code API?

A QR Code API is an Application Programming Interface that allows software developers to build QR code functionality into their software applications. These APIs provide developers with a set of tools that they can use to create and customize QR codes that suit their requirements, including data formats, size, color, and design.

Key Features of QR Code APIs

Some of the key features offered by QR code APIs include customization options, real-time tracking, and analytics. Developers can use these features to track user engagement with their QR codes and improve the overall user experience. Additionally, developers can integrate QR codes into their products to track user data, such as device usage and location data.

Popular QR Code API Providers

Several third-party vendors offer QR code APIs that can be integrated into software applications, including QR Code Generator, QR Code Monkey, and QR Code API. These vendors' pricing models for their APIs vary, but most offer a free trial or freemium version for developers to test and explore the functionality before purchase.

Generating QR Codes with APIs

Developers can use QR code APIs to generate QR codes that can be easily integrated into their software applications. The process involves encoding data into a QR code image and then customizing it based on specific needs.

Step-by-Step Guide to Create QR Codes

The following are the steps involved in creating a QR code using QR code APIs:

  1. Choose a QR code API provider and sign up for an account.

  2. Generate a QR code by encoding the required data, such as a link or content.

  3. Customize the QR code by selecting the size, color, and design.

  4. Test the QR code for functionality and readability.

  5. Integrate the generated QR code into the desired software application or website.

Customizing QR Code Appearance

QR code APIs offer customization options that allow developers to create QR codes that align with their branding guidelines and enhance user engagement. These customization options include changing the color, adding a logo or image, and customizing the QR code's design and layout.

Encoding Different Types of Data

QR code APIs can encode various types of data, including text, images, URLs, and contact information. Developers can encode data using different formats, such as alphanumeric or numeric, based on the intended use of the QR code.


QR code APIs have transformed the way software developers integrate and use QR code functionality within their applications. Developers can now create customized QR codes that match their requirements, track user data, and analyze user engagement. With the increasing use of QR codes in advertising, marketing, and payment methods, it is essential for developers to understand how QR code APIs can facilitate and enhance software functionality.